The New York Knicks suffered a 140-134 loss to the Minnesota Timberwolves in a recent game.
The Knicks had difficulties with their defense and were unable to keep up with the Timberwolves' strong offense.
The Timberwolves were particularly impressive from beyond the arc, shooting 77% from 3-point range in the first half and finishing the game with a 61% field goal percentage.
Mitchell Robinson's rebound positioning and chase for blocks created issues for the Knicks' defense.
Immanuel Quickley, one of the Knicks' most disciplined defenders, fouled Mike Conley on a 3-pointer due to being caught out of position.
The Knicks were unable to assert their defensive presence and couldn't mount a comeback after falling behind.
